Overview Sildonyx 4 Capsule
Silodyne 4mg capsules, an alpha-blocker, treat ben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H) by easing urinary symptoms. Importantly, it doesn't shrink the prostate. Always follow your doctor's prescribed dosage and schedule. Take with food, consistently at the same time each day. Swallow whole; do not crush or chew. Discontinuing treatment prematurely may worsen symptoms; complete the prescribed course for optimal results. Common side effects include dizziness, diarrhea, retrograde ejaculation, orthostatic hypotension, headache, nasal congestion, and nasopharyngitis. Report any persistent or bothersome side effects immediately to your physician. Lifestyle adjustments can aid symptom management. Urinate promptly when you feel the urge, but avoid straining. Limit evening and pre-sleep consumption of caffeinated and alcoholic beverages. Inform your doctor of all other medications before starting treatment. If undergoing cataract or glaucoma surgery, notify your ophthalmologist of Silodyne 4mg use. Individuals with liver or kidney impairment require careful monitoring and regular follow-up appointments as directed by their doctor.

Common Side effects of Sildonyx 4 Capsule:
- Retrograde ejaculation
- Dizziness
- Diarrhea
- Orthostatic hypotension (sudden lowering of blood pressure on standing)
- Headache
- Blurred vision
- Nasopharyngitis (inflammation of the throat and nasal passages)
- Nasal congestion (stuffy nose)

How Sildonyx 4 Capsule works:
Sildonyx 4 Capsules function as an alpha-adrenergic antagonist, easing muscle tension in the bladder neck and prostate to facilitate smoother urination.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Concurrent use of Sildonyx 4 Capsules and alcohol may lead to significant sleepiness.
Preg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Use of Sildonyx 4 Capsules during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no harmful consequences for fetal development; clinical data in humans, however, remains scarce.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Data on the compatibility of Sildonyx 4 Capsule with breastfeeding is lacking. Seek medical advice from your physician. Silodosin is contraindicated in female patients.
DrivingCAUTION
Taking Sildonyx 4 Capsules might lead to lightheadedness or fatigue from lowered blood pressure.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should use Sildonyx 4 Capsules c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ification under medical supervision. Sildonyx 4 Capsules are contraindicated in individuals with severe kidney disease.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with severe hepatic impairment should exercise caution when using Sildonyx 4 Capsules. Dosage modification may be necessary. A physician's consultation is recommended. Data regarding Sildonyx 4 Capsule use in this patient population is limited.
What if you forget to take Sildonyx 4 Capsule :
Should you forget a Sildonyx 4 Capsule dose,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
